Key Principles and Regulatory Frameworks in Environmental Technology Law
Key principles in environmental technology law center on promoting sustainable development while ensuring technological innovation aligns with environmental protection. These principles emphasize the importance of precaution, preventive action, and polluter pays, fostering responsible behavior among stakeholders.
Regulatory frameworks include international agreements and national legislation that set standards for environmental technologies. International frameworks such as the Paris Agreement influence global commitments, whereas countries develop specific laws to regulate emissions, waste management, and technological deployment, ensuring consistency and accountability.
Effective legal regulation in this domain also involves clear enforcement mechanisms and compliance systems. These frameworks establish penalties for violations and facilitate monitoring to uphold environmental standards. They aim to balance innovation with accountability, encouraging continuous improvement in environmental technology practices.

The Role of Environmental Impact Assessments in Technological Implementations
Environmental Impact Assessments (EIAs) serve a vital function in ensuring that technological implementations align with environmental sustainability standards. They systematically evaluate potential environmental effects before project approval, facilitating informed decision-making processes.
EIAs help identify possible adverse impacts, such as pollution, habitat disruption, or resource depletion, enabling developers to modify or adapt technologies accordingly. This proactive approach minimizes ecological harm and promotes sustainable innovation.
Legal frameworks often mandate EIAs as part of environmental technology law fundamentals, safeguarding public interest and ecological integrity. Consequently, they foster transparency and accountability throughout the project lifecycle.
In sum, EIAs are integral to balancing technological advancement with environmental protection, ensuring compliance with national and international regulations while encouraging responsible innovation.

Intellectual Property Rights and Environmental Technologies
Intellectual property rights (IPR) are integral to the development and dissemination of environmental technologies. They protect innovations, enabling inventors and companies to secure exclusive rights that incentivize research and investment. In the context of environmental technology law, IPR fosters sustainable development by encouraging the creation of novel solutions to environmental challenges.
Legal frameworks governing IPR must balance the interests of innovators with public access to environmentally beneficial technologies. Patents, copyrights, and trade secrets are commonly used tools to safeguard advances such as renewable energy devices, pollution control systems, or eco-friendly materials. These protections ensure innovators can recover investments while promoting further technological progress.
However, challenges arise regarding patent accessibility and licensing, particularly across different jurisdictions. Issues related to traditional knowledge and the sharing of environmentally critical technologies often demand special considerations under environmental technology law. A clear understanding of IPR is essential for fostering innovation within a legal structure that promotes both progress and environmental protection.
Enforcement Mechanisms and Penalties in Environmental Technology Law
Enforcement mechanisms and penalties play a vital role in ensuring compliance with environmental technology law. They establish accountability by holding entities responsible for violations related to environmental regulations and standards. Robust enforcement tools include inspections, audits, and monitoring systems, which help verify adherence to legal requirements.
Penalties for non-compliance vary depending on the severity of the violation. They may involve monetary fines, suspension of operations, or criminal charges in extreme cases. These penalties serve as deterrents, discouraging negligent or intentional breaches of environmental technology laws.
Legal frameworks also authorize administrative sanctions, such as license revocations or restrictions. Additionally, some jurisdictions employ corrective measures, requiring violators to implement remedial actions. Enforcement agencies often collaborate internationally to address transboundary issues, ensuring comprehensive oversight.
Overall, effective enforcement mechanisms and penalties are essential for promoting sustainable technological advancements and safeguarding environmental integrity within the scope of environmental technology law.
